#b15c0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b15c0e is composed of 69.4% red, 36.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 37.5%. #b15c0e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b81c with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#b15c0e color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#b15c0e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b15c0e has RGB values of R:177, G:92,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.92,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11623438.

Shades and Tints of #b15c0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0701 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b15c0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605f5f is the less saturated color, while #b85c07 is the most saturated one.
